What Is an Ohlins Steering Damper and Why Does It Matter?

A steering damper is a hydraulic or friction device that resists sudden, uncontrolled handlebar oscillations – the phenomenon that riders call ‘tank slapper’ or ‘death wobble’. At high speeds or after hitting a bump mid-corner, the front wheel can momentarily lose traction and begin oscillating rapidly. Without a steering damper, these oscillations can escalate into a full loss of control within milliseconds.
Ohlins is the Swedish suspension specialist that supplies components to MotoGP and WSBK teams. Their steering dampers use a unique SDU (Steering Damping Unit) oil-based design that provides progressive resistance – light at low speeds (so it does not affect slow-speed manoeuvring) and increasingly firm at high speeds where stability is critical. On a 636cc supersport motorcycle capable of 240+ kmph, an Ohlins steering damper is not a luxury accessory; it is meaningful safety equipment.
Kawasaki Ninja ZX-6R 2026 – Full Spec Sheet
| Specification | Kawasaki Ninja ZX-6R 2026 |
| Engine | 636cc inline four-cylinder, liquid-cooled, DOHC |
| Max Power | 128 bhp @ 13,000 rpm |
| Max Torque | 70.8 Nm @ 11,000 rpm |
| Transmission | 6-speed with Kawasaki Quick Shifter (KQS) standard |
| Front Suspension | 41mm inverted cartridge forks – fully adjustable |
| Rear Suspension | Horizontal back-link, fully adjustable |
| Front Brake | Dual 310 mm discs, radial-mount 4-piston Nissin calipers |
| Electronics | KIBS (Kawasaki Intelligent anti-lock Brake System), Power Modes (Full/Low), Traction Control |
| Ohlins Damper (new offer) | Ohlins SDU steering damper – factory fitted, free with every purchase |
| Kerb Weight | 196 kg (wet) |
| Fuel Tank | 17 litres |
| Price | Rs 11.37 lakh (ex-showroom) – unchanged with Ohlins offer included |
ZX-6R vs Competitors – Is It Still the Best 600cc Supersport?
| Bike | Engine | Power | Price India | Key Advantage |
| Kawasaki Ninja ZX-6R | 636cc I4 | 128 bhp | Rs 11.37L | 636cc advantage over 600, inline four character |
| Honda CBR650R | 649cc I4 | 94 bhp | Rs 8.65L | Smoother, more accessible, Honda reliability |
| Yamaha YZF-R7 | 689cc parallel twin | 73.4 bhp | Rs 8.99L | Handling balance, lighter weight |
| Ducati Panigale V2 | 955cc L-twin | 153 bhp | Rs 21.49L | Outright performance, Italian prestige |
| Triumph Daytona 660 | 660cc triple | 94 bhp | Rs 11.26L | Triple cylinder character, handling finesse |

The ZX-6R remains the most powerful bike in the true 600cc supersport class available in India. The 636cc engine produces 128 bhp – significantly more than any competitor in similar displacement. Q: Is the Kawasaki Ninja ZX-6R practical for daily commuting in India?
A: The ZX-6R is an uncompromising supersport motorcycle optimised for track days and spirited highway riding. Its aggressive riding position, high-revving power band, and firm suspension make it genuinely uncomfortable for stop-go city commuting. As a weekend and highway machine for enthusiasts, it is excellent. As a daily commuter, it is the wrong tool for the job.
Q: Can a beginner rider handle the Kawasaki Ninja ZX-6R?
A: The ZX-6R produces 128 bhp and reaches 100 kmph in well under 4 seconds. It is not recommended as a first or second motorcycle. Kawasaki recommends prior experience on at least a 300–400cc motorcycle before transitioning to the ZX-6R. The Low Power mode reduces output somewhat, but the bike’s aggressive chassis and ergonomics still demand experienced riders.
Q: Is service support available for the ZX-6R across India?
A: Kawasaki India has authorized service centres in all major cities and most state capitals. However, as a premium performance motorcycle, genuine spare parts can take longer to procure in smaller cities. If you are based in a tier-2 or tier-3 city, confirm parts availability with your nearest Kawasaki dealer before purchase.
